新型同步控制回路设计与分析

Analysis and Design for a New Synchronization Control Circuit

【摘要】 为解决超静定液压支架调架过程中立柱无法同时升降的问题,对比各种同步回路,选择同步缸同步回路。借鉴传统同步回路,设计新型同步回路控制策略,搭建新型控制回路AMESim模型并进行仿真。根据输出数据进行定量分析,研究各个支路的状态,确定同步回路的工作状态。

【Abstract】 In order to solve the problem of pillar synchronous obstacles in up and down,and adjustable difficulty of hyperstatic hydraulic support,by contrasting several synchronization circuits,synchronization cylinder synchronization circuit was selected. The new synchronization control circuit was designed by referenced to traditional synchronization circuit,a model of the new control circuit was established and simulated by AMESim. Quantitative analysis was carried out according to the output data. The state of each branch circuit was researched,and the working state of the synchronization circuit was determinated.
